Alert: STATIC_REBUILD_FULL_FALLBACK. This fires when the Hollybright site generator abandons an incremental rebuild and falls back to a full rebuild, usually because the dependency graph cache was invalidated or a shared layout changed. Full rebuilds take ~40 minutes versus 2, so publishing appears stalled. Check the cache invalidation log before assuming a failure. The triage flowchart and cache reset steps are on the page below.

dashboard of yafog-fajof = https://jira.tolvaqsys.internal/pages/pages/projects/49fe21c4

The thumbnail cache in the Pixvault renderer grows unbounded on the staging cluster. Root cause: CACHE_EVICTION_POLICY was unset, so the service defaulted to keep-all instead of LRU. Heap climbs roughly 200MB per hour under normal load until the pod is OOM-killed. Fix is to set the eviction policy and cap CACHE_MAX_ENTRIES at 10000. While correcting the env file, also note that the cache's upstream fetcher needs its auth credential, which goes on the line directly below this one.

env line for fafof-fahag: LEDGER_TOKEN5=f8790

TICKET GV-2214 — Donation receipt mailer sends duplicate receipts
Severity: High. Blocks 4.2 release.

Repro:
1. Log into GiveVine staging as org admin.
2. Create a one-time donation of any amount.
3. Trigger the receipt job twice within 60s.
4. Donor inbox receives two receipts with identical receipt numbers.

Expected: idempotency key dedupes the second send.
Actual: mailer queue ignores the key.

To replay against the mailer API directly, authenticate with the staging bearer token below.

session JWT of yawep-yawep = eyJhbGciOiJIUzI1NiIsInR5cCI6IkpXVCJ9.eyJzdWIiOiI3pWF3_In0.aXYsHiog

Subject: Cron-to-Windmere cut-over summary

Hello plugin authors — as of this morning, all scheduled jobs on the Larkspur platform have been migrated from host-level cron to the Windmere workflow engine. Legacy crontabs have been disabled but preserved for thirty days. Plugins registering scheduled tasks must now declare them via the Windmere manifest; direct cron registration will be rejected. The engine settings your plugins will run under are the following.

settings of kahag-bagug:
[quenath]
port = 6379
region = outer-2
host = quenath.nelvrocorp.internal
timeout_ms = 2000
retries = 3